MLB Standings: Dodgers Open Up Big Lead In National League West

The Los Angeles Dodgers opened their three-game series with the San Francisco Giants with a 9-1 win Monday night, an always welcome accomplishment against their longtime rivals. The win opened an eight-game homestand for the Dodgers, with all eight games against National League West opponents.

In face, the next 10 games for the Dodgers are against divisional foes, with a two-game trip to San Diego to face the Padres on the docket next week. The Dodgers have built a five-game lead in the NL West, and have an opportunity to widen that gap with some strong home play. Here are the NL West standings:

National League West Standings
Team W-L Pct GB
Dodgers 19-10 .655 ---
San Francisco 14-15 .483 5
Arizona 14-16 .467
Colorado 12-16 .425
San Diego 10-20 .333
Through games of May 7

The five-game lead is the largest of the season for the Dodgers. The Dodgers are 11-2 at home this season, and play 17 of their next 22 games at Dodger Stadium.
